Output 03c24d874c53c46cd5149247e73979758a69d0973a7fa82047f2020796610eca:2

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95f3f8cb17c1aeaea99f96776d0c0f50953d47d6 OP_EQUAL
address
3FMtsb3NvdTiDU2t4D6M5NGr2qHcTFKaza
transaction
03c24d874c53c46cd5149247e73979758a69d0973a7fa82047f2020796610eca
spent
true